The present invention relates to a method for improving a piezoelectric transformer internal electrode fusing mask to improve productivity of a 2W-class contour type step-down piezoelectric transformer. According to the present invention, in a conventional process of manufacturing a contour type piezoelectric transformer, a green sheet is manufactured through a tape-casting process using powder which is a raw material, as slurry. Thereafter, an internal electrode is applied on the manufactured green sheet, and the method proposed by the present invention is different from a conventional method for an internal electrode fusing mask. According to a conventional mask design method, a forward arrangement is used for visibility and accuracy. However, according to the conventional invention, an empty space is positioned between one internal electrode and the next internal electrode of a cutting blade, such that waste of materials is caused and also, the number of cutting times is increased. Therefore, a plurality of piezoelectric transformer internal electrodes can be cut by one cutting by attaching a cutting edge of all internal electrodes, and the cutting process efficiency can be maximized by minimizing raw materials wasted in a space therebetween.;COPYRIGHT KIPO 2019
